To start an enterprise server

  1. In the table of servers on the Home page of Enterprise Server Administration, find the row for the server that you want to start, and click Start in the Current Status column.

    A screen is displayed indicating the server details and security configuration information. This screen also gives you the option of specifying operating system and Enterprise Server security credentials to be used. For more about security credentials, see Configuring Credentials for Starting and Stopping Enterprise Servers.

  2. Click OK.

    The Home page of Enterprise Server Administration is displayed, and the value in Current Status for this server changes to "Starting". If you have Show local console checked on the Edit Server page, the enterprise server console daemon window appears indicating the progress of the process of starting the server.

  3. After a few seconds click Refresh on the Home page.

    The value in Current Status changes to "Started".

Note:

If the server remains in the "Starting" state for a prolonged time the reason might be that it has encountered an unrecoverable error but the server process remains active. In this case click Details to go to the Server > Control page, then click Stop Server to shut down the unsuccessful server process. Alternatively it might have encountered an unrecoverable error during the startup process and shut down without informing the Directory Server. In this case you can restart it using Start Server on the Server > Control page.
